Strong’s Definitions

κωμόπολις kōmópolis, ko-mop'-ol-is; from G2968 and G4172; an unwalled city:—town.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 1x

The KJV translates Strong's G2969 in the following manner: town (1x).

STRONGS G2969:
κωμόπολις, κωμοπολεως, , a village approximating in size and number of inhabitants to a city, a village-city, a town (German Marktflecken): Mark 1:38. (Strabo; (Joshua 18:28 Aq. Theod. (Field)); often in the Byzantine writings of the middle ages.)
